How To Fix CTS_PLG_MSG000 - Plugin &1 already activated in system &2. Perform auto-update to repair.


CTS_PLG_MSG000 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: CTS_PLG_MSG - Plugin messages

  • Message number: 000

  • Message text: Plugin &1 already activated in system &2. Perform auto-update to repair.

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message CTS_PLG_MSG000 - Plugin &1 already activated in system &2. Perform auto-update to repair. ?
    The SAP error message CTS_PLG_MSG000 indicates that a specific plugin (denoted as &1) is already activated in the system (denoted as &2). This message typically arises in the context of the Change and Transport System (CTS) when there is an attempt to activate a plugin that is already active, or when there is a mismatch in the plugin's state.
    
    Cause: Duplicate Activation Attempt: The plugin you are trying to activate is already active in the system. Inconsistent State: There may be inconsistencies in the plugin's state, possibly due to a failed update or an incomplete installation. Version Mismatch: The version of the plugin you are trying to activate may not match the version that is already installed.
